"Classic Korean barbecue Soowon might get a little overshadowed by its neighbor Park’s BBQ down the street, but the longtime restaurant still excels with high-quality beef and attentive service. A reliable star in the galaxy of Koreatown barbecue." - Matthew Kang, Cathy Park
